Using a Data-Driven Improvement Methodology to Decrease Surgical Site Infections in a Community Neurosurgery

A new protocol significantly reduced surgical site infections in neurosurgery patients, decreasing the rate from 6.7% to 0.96%. This quality improvement initiative enhanced patient safety and care value.
Area of Science:
- Neurosurgery
- Infectious Disease Control
- Quality Improvement
Background:
- Surgical site infections (SSIs) pose a significant risk to neurosurgical patients.
- Existing protocols for preoperative antibiotic use and infection prevention had limitations.
Purpose of the Study:
- To implement and evaluate a data-driven methodology to decrease the departmental surgical site infection rate in neurosurgery.
- To achieve a target SSI rate of 1%.
Main Methods:
- A prospective interventional study with historical controls was conducted.
- Interventions included optimized preoperative chlorhexidine showers, methicillin-sensitive Staphylococcus aureus (MSSA)/methicillin-resistant Staphylococcus aureus (MRSA) screening and decolonization, and an optimized preoperative antibiotic order set.
- The American College of Surgeons National Surgical Quality Improvement Program (NSQIP) was used for surveillance.
Main Results:
- Analysis of 317 NSQIP neurosurgical cases (163 pre-implementation, 154 post-implementation) showed no significant demographic differences, except for inpatient and functional status.
- The SSI rate decreased from 6.7% to 0.96% post-implementation.
- The implementation cost was $27,179, averaging $58 per patient.
Conclusions:
- Systematic investigation of clinical practice gaps is crucial for enhancing patient safety in neurosurgery.
- Quality improvement projects can effectively increase patient safety and the value of care.
- The implemented protocol demonstrated significant success in reducing SSIs.
